Ingredients

  • 2 cups pitted Medjool dates, chopped

  • 1 cup water

  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

  • 2 cups old-fashioned oats

  • 1½ cups all-purpose flour

  • 1 cup packed brown sugar

  • ½ teaspoon salt

  • ¾ cup cold butter, cubed

  • ½ teaspoon cinnamon

Directions

  • Preheat oven to 350°F. Line an 8×8 inch pan with parchment paper.
  • In a saucepan, combine chopped dates, water, and vanilla. Simmer 10-15 minutes until thick and spreadable. Set aside to cool.
  • In a large bowl, mix oats, flour, brown sugar, salt, and cinnamon.
  • Cut in cold butter until m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
  • Press half the oat mixture firmly into prepared pan.
  • Spread date mixture evenly over crust.
  • Sprinkle remaining oat mixture on top, pressing lightly.
  • Bake 30-35 minutes until golden brown.
  • Cool completely before cutting into squares.

Notes

  • For extra richness, add ¼ cup chopped walnuts to the oat mixture
    Squares can be stored covered at room temperature for up to 5 days
    For clean cuts, chill bars before slicing

Pro Tips for Perfect Squares

Pro Tips for Perfect Squares

The key to stellar galactic date squares is patience during the cooling process. Cutting them too early will result in messy, crumbly pieces that won’t hold their shape.

For ultra-clean cuts, refrigerate the cooled bars for at least 2 hours before slicing. Use a sharp knife and wipe it clean between cuts for professional-looking squares.

If your date mixture seems too thick, add a tablespoon of water at a time until it reaches a spreadable consistency. Too thin? Simmer a few minutes longer to reduce excess moisture.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use different types of dates for galactic date squares?

Yes, Deglet Noor dates work well, though you may need to soak them in warm water for 10 minutes first to soften them properly.

How do I know when the galactic date squares are done baking?

The top should be golden brown and set to the touch. The edges will pull slightly away from the pan when fully baked.

Can I make galactic date squares gluten-free?

Absolutely! Replace the all-purpose flour with a 1:1 gluten-free flour blend or use certified gluten-free oats and oat flour.

Why are my date squares too sweet?

Try reducing the brown sugar by ¼ cup or using less sweet dates. Natural date sweetness can vary significantly.

Can I prepare galactic date squares ahead of time?

Yes, these squares actually taste better the next day. Make them up to 3 days ahead and store covered at room temperature.
